AI Roguelite is a text-driven RPG that relies on artificial intelligence to shape all locations, NPCs, adversaries, items, crafting recipes, and game mechanics. It features AI-generated entities, combat, crafting recipes, and visuals. The game is presently in Early Access, with a full release scheduled for March 2022.

Inworld AI offers a platform for developers and creators to design realistic AI characters suited for games, virtual environments, entertainment, digital workforces, and additional applications. With a user-friendly interface, the platform allows the creation of AI characters using natural language prompts, straightforward controls, and 20 machine learning models that enable authentic behavior and emotions. These AI characters, once developed, can be integrated into different game engines and virtual settings.

Matrix-Game 2.0 is an open AI model that generates real-time interactive video within a virtual environment at an impressive speed of 25 frames per second. This tool enables users to control characters and camera movements using simple keyboard commands, creating seamless minute-long video sequences in various visual styles and scenarios. Matrix-Game utilizes advanced AI technologies to maintain physical consistency in character movements, adapting to different environments. This makes it indispensable for game developers prototyping virtual worlds, researchers studying embodied intelligence, and content creators seeking rapid visualization tools.
